Esempio n. 1
0
        public void RideControllerCreateReturnsView_ExpectedSuccess()
        {
            // Arrange
            var rides = GetRides();
            var _mock = new Mock <IRideLogic>();

            _mock.Setup(x => x.GetDriverRides(It.IsAny <Int32>())).ReturnsAsync(rides);
            var controllerUnderTest = new RideController(_context, _mock.Object);

            // Act
            var result = controllerUnderTest.Create(GetRide());

            // Assert
            var viewResult = Assert.IsType <Task <IActionResult> >(result);
        }